Face ancient terrors in the Aztec realm of Death Relives
Death Relives is a chilling first-person survival horror game that immerses players in a nightmarish world steeped in Aztec mythology. The story follows Adrian, a teenager on a desperate mission to save his mother from being sacrificed to Xipe Totec, the fearsome Aztec god of death, rebirth, and agriculture. Set in a haunting mansion that has hosted this ancient deity for decades, players must navigate a treacherous environment filled with dread and deadly challenges. The narrative weaves historical Aztec elements with a gripping, story-driven experience, as Adrian uncovers disturbing secrets about his mother's fate and the dark rituals tied to Xipe Totec. The game's atmosphere is thick with tension, blending psychological horror with survival mechanics to keep players on edge.

The game's standout features elevate it beyond typical horror titles. Its unique villain AI design ensures Xipe Totec is a relentless pursuer, reacting dynamically to sound and player actions, making every encounter unpredictable and intense. Players must rely on stealth, hiding, and basic equipment—no superpowers here—adding a layer of realism to the survival experience. The game also integrates innovative mechanics, such as the ability to connect your real phone to interact with Adrian's in-game phone, where puzzles can be solved, and glitches signal the god's approach, heightening immersion. Puzzles are intricately tied to the story, requiring players to solve them while evading danger, and a special weapon crafted from the tears of Tlaloc, the Aztec god of rain, offers a unique combat option. The rich narrative, enhanced by collaboration with film and television professionals, ensures a cinematic and immersive storyline that delves deep into Aztec lore.
